Farouche
adjective
Unsociable or shy and socially awkward.
Disorderly or intimidating in appearance or behavior; wild.
Outrageous or extreme.
Sullen or recalcitrant.

found an interesting translation thing in today's les mis letters chapter. i've been listening to the donougher translation bc i haven't read that one through yet and i heard "bristling and farouche" and thought, huh, i know that word! and hapgood says "bristling and wild" so i suppose that makes sense? so i went to cross-reference and turns out in the french (at least my editions) the phrase is "hérissée et fauve". my french is extremely basic but a quick dictionary search gives me "wild animal" for "fauve", which, okay i guess, that's why hapgood has gone with "wild", but then why has donougher gone with "farouche"? it's a loanword from french too and it's used similarly in english as in french from what i can tell - but why pick another french word meaning "wild" when "wild" is right there!
